더북(TheBook)

worker_threads의 예제와 모양이 비슷합니다. 다만, 스레드가 아니라 프로세스입니다. 클러스터에는 마스터 프로세스와 워커 프로세스가 있습니다. 마스터 프로세스는 CPU 개수만큼 워커 프로세스를 만들고, 8086번 포트에서 대기합니다. 요청이 들어오면 만들어진 워커 프로세스에 요청을 분배합니다.

▲ 그림 4-21 클러스터링

워커 프로세스가 실질적인 일을 하는 프로세스입니다. 이 책에서 실험한 컴퓨터는 CPU 코어가 여섯 개이므로 워커가 여섯 개 생성되었습니다. 실제로 여섯 개가 생성되었는지 확인해보겠습니다.

코드를 다음과 같이 수정합니다.

신간 소식 구독하기
뉴스레터에 가입하시고 이메일로 신간 소식을 받아 보세요.